Frequently Asked Questions

How many private schools are located in 85395, AZ?
5 private schools are located in 85395, AZ.
How diverse are private schools in 85395?
85395 private schools are approximately 30% minority students, which is lower than the Arizona private school average of 39%.
What percentage of students in 85395 go to private school?
13% of all K-12 students in 85395 are educated in private schools (compared to the AZ state average of 7%).
